The other day I pulled a huge stack of my button down blouses out of the closet and went to town ironing shut the boob gaps.  You know what I am talking about - that annoying thing your shirt does once you are past the 6th grade.

It is super easy.  All you need is an iron, a package of Heat'n Bond and some scissors.


Cut strips to fit the the spots between the buttons and then remove one side of the paper.  Iron this onto the fabric and then let it cool.  Once cooled, remove the other part of the paper and rebutton the shirt.  You then iron the area again, bonding the fabric together.

You can wash and iron like normal.  I normally don't tumble dry shirts like this, but I would assume drying on low heat would be ok. 

Once completed, you will have a stack full of blouses that won't expose your boobs/bra.
